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ost in Osawatomie, KS

The cost of carpet water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 The extent of the damage and size of the affected area will impact the cost of this service.
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The type of cleaning solutions used and the amount of equipment required will impact the cost of this service.
Restoration and rebuilding $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ials required for restoration will impact the cost of this service.
Moisture detection and testing $100 – $500 The complexity of the job and the number of tests required will impact the cost of this service.
Equipment rental and usage $50 – $200 The type and duration of equipment rental will impact the cost of this service.

Can I prevent carpet water damage?

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ent carpet water damage. Regularly inspect your home for signs of water damage, fix any leaks quickly, and consider installing a water alarm system.
